Jack Jackson loved American history and creating comics. He combined these into a single vocation and created an unparalleled legacy of historical graphic novels. Los Tejanos is the story of the Texas-Mexican conflict, as seen through the eyes of Juan Seguin, a Texan of Mexican descent. A pivotal and tragic figure, through him Jackson humanises this vast and complex story of war. Lost Cause deals with post-civil-war reconstruction. The tensions caused during this violent time are told through the Taylor-Sutton feud, which raged across South Texas.
